About Cnot3

Summary

Involved in positive regulation of cold-induced thermogenesis; regulation of stem cell population maintenance; and trophectodermal cell differentiation. Located in P-body. Is expressed in several structures, including alimentary system; brain; gonad; hemolymphoid system gland; and white fat. Orthologous to human CNOT3 (CCR4-NOT transcription complex subunit 3).
